The number was assigned to Spur 9 originally, which was designated from US 70 to Olton on September 26, 1939, as a renumbering of SH 28 Spur. [3] On June 21, 1955, this became part of FM 304, which became part of FM 168 on October 31, 1958. [4] On May 6, 1969, Loop 9 was designated from I-20 north, east, south, west, and northwest back to I-20.
